When to Use Dethalia Script as a Headline, Logo, or Accent

One of the most practical questions business owners ask is how to use a decorative font without overwhelming their design. Dethalia Script shines as a display font. Use it for your brand name, taglines, product titles, and key headings. It grabs attention and sets the tone. For body text, smaller labels, or lengthy product descriptions, pair it with a neutral sans serif font or a readable serif font. This keeps your materials functional while preserving your brand personality.

In logo design, Dethalia Script can stand alone or combine with a simple icon. A boutique owner might use it for the shop name with a subtle swash underline. A beauty brand could place it above a minimalist emblem. The key is to let the font breathe. Give it enough space so the swashes don’t crowd other elements. On a business card, use Dethalia Script for your name or business name, and a plain sans serif for contact details. This creates hierarchy without confusion.

Readability in Real Business Settings

Readability matters more than many designers admit. A font that looks gorgeous on a poster might be impossible to read on a mobile phone or a tiny label. Dethalia Script is a modern calligraphy font with fairly generous letter spacing and clear shapes. It works on small labels, Instagram thumbnails, and packaging as long as you keep the text size reasonable. Avoid using it for long paragraphs or very small print. For ingredient lists, shipping details, or legal disclaimers, stick with a simpler typeface.

When printing on physical products, test the font at the actual size you plan to use. A swash that looks delicate on screen may become muddy on a kraft paper label or too faint on a dark surface. Print a sample, hold it in your hand, and see how it reads. This simple step saves you from investing in packaging that doesn’t match your vision.

Testing Dethalia Script Before Committing to a Full Brand

Jumping into a full rebrand is daunting. A smarter approach is to test Dethalia Script on one or two materials first. Create a social media graphic, a product label, or a draft of your logo. Live with it for a few days. Ask a few trusted customers or friends what they notice. Does the font feel aligned with your products? Does it stand out in a crowded feed? Does it still look good in black and white or when printed small?

Testing also helps you decide how much to use the swashes. Dethalia Script includes plenty of decorative alternates, but more is not always better. A single swash on a logo can feel elegant. Five swashes on a business card can feel chaotic. Start minimal, then add ornamentation only where it enhances your message.

Simple Font Pairing Ideas for a Polished Look

Pairing Dethalia Script with another font helps your brand feel complete. A classic choice is to match it with a clean sans serif font. The contrast between flowing script and simple geometry creates visual interest while keeping everything easy to read. Think of using a sans serif for menus, product descriptions, and body text, while reserving Dethalia Script for headlines and names.

If your brand leans more traditional or elegant, a readable serif font can complement the script nicely. The serif adds structure, and the script adds personality. For digital materials, a thin serif can keep your website looking airy and modern. For printed materials, a sturdy serif grounds the design. Whichever direction you choose, keep the pairing to two fonts. Three or more can confuse your brand identity and make your materials feel scattered.

Checking Commercial Licensing Before You Publish

Before you place Dethalia Script on your product packaging, website, or merchandise, take a moment to review the commercial licensing. Not all fonts allow you to use them for business purposes without an extended license. If you plan to sell products with the font on the label, use it in templates, include it in client work, or offer digital downloads, you need to confirm that your license covers those uses.

Most Script Amp fonts come with clear licensing terms. Read them carefully. Purchasing a commercial license upfront saves you from legal headaches later and ensures your brand materials remain yours to use freely. It is a small investment that protects your business and respects the work of the type designer.
